    Great video bro. Coukd you make a video about building credit in finland?

    • @AleksiHimself
      @AleksiHimself  Před rokem +1

      We don't have such system in Finland. When you move to Finland, you have "no rating". When you live here for two years, you'll have "good standing". You can lose your credit rating if you ignore a bill for two long.

    • @lucasmendes4982
      @lucasmendes4982 Před rokem

      @@AleksiHimself i see. Here in america you need to build credit to get low rates when getting a loan or mortgage. So does everyone get the same rates?

    • @AleksiHimself
      @AleksiHimself  Před rokem +2

      Banks assess each case individually by looking at income and costs. If your finances are stable and predictable, banks will see less risk and give you better rates. You can also negotiate and ask multiple offers from different banks to lever better offers.
